Zacary T Thurman 1917 - 1981

Zacary T Thurman of Mineola, Nassau County, NY was born on October 7, 1917, and died at age 63 years old on May 23, 1981. Zacary Thurman was buried at Calverton National Cemetery Section 3 Site 355 210 Princeton Boulevard - Rt 25, in Calverton.

Did you know?
In 1917, in the year that Zacary T Thurman was born, Dutch exotic dancer Mata Hari was convicted and executed as a German spy. Since Mata Hari, born Margaretha Geertruida "Margreet" MacLeod, was a citizen of the Netherlands (which remained neutral in World War 1), she could travel freely in Europe. Her travels (and her romantic entanglements) raised suspicion and she was arrested by the French and found guilty. There is still controversy about her guilt although her name has become synonymous with a seductive female spy.
Did you know?
In 1929, by the time this person was only 12 years old, American Samoa officially became a U.S. territory. Although a part of the United States since 1900, the Ratification Act of 1929 vested "all civil, judicial, and military powers in the President of the United States of America".
